- Joseph William Frazier (January 12, 1944 - November 7, 2011), nicknamed "Smokin' Joe", was an American professional boxer who competed from 1965 to 1981. He reigned as the undisputed heavyweight champion from 1970 to 1973, and as an amateur won a gold medal at the 1964 Summer Olympics.

Joe Frazier's routine:
Morning: 3-3.5 miles running in army boots
Gym:
Loosen up 10 min
-3 rounds of shadow boxing
-3 or 8 rounds of sparring
-3 rounds on heavy bag
-3 rounds on speed-bag
- 15min jumping rope
- 4 or 5 sets of calisthenics (push-ups,pull-ups or dips , super-set)
- Abdominals + stretching.
On "easier days" , he did mitts or medicine ball(punching) instead of sparring + couple of rounds on double end bag.
